Understanding Medical Transcription Apps: A Key Tool for Healthcare Providers
Medical transcription apps are advanced software tools that transform spoken language into written text, specifically designed for the medical setting. These apps utilize cutting-edge speech recognition technology to accurately transcribe clinical dictations, allowing providers to document interactions with remarkable efficiency. By automating the documentation process, medical transcription apps significantly reduce the time healthcare professionals spend on paperwork, enabling them to focus more on what truly matters—patient care.
In 2025, integrating health record apps into daily practice is essential for providers seeking to enhance operational effectiveness and user involvement. Notable examples include Sunoh.ai and Dragon Medical One, both of which seamlessly integrate with electronic health records (EHR). This ensures that patient data is not only captured accurately but also easily accessible, streamlining workflows and improving the overall quality of care.

Ensuring Security and Compliance in Medical Transcription Practices
Ensuring security and compliance in medical documentation practices is not just a necessity; it is vital for protecting patient information and maintaining trust within the healthcare system. Healthcare providers often face overwhelming administrative burdens, and utilizing medical transcription apps that comply with regulations such as HIPAA can alleviate some of this stress. HIPAA establishes stringent guidelines for managing protected health information (PHI), and adhering to these standards is crucial for safeguarding sensitive data.
To achieve compliance, providers should thoughtfully select medical transcription apps that incorporate:
- Robust encryption protocols
- Secure data storage options
- Regular compliance audits
These features are essential in protecting patient data against unauthorized access and breaches. For instance, BastionGPT serves as a HIPAA-compliant AI tool designed specifically for medical professionals, offering high-quality documentation while ensuring the privacy of personal data.
This solution not only enhances operational efficiency but also addresses sensitive health topics with care, without compromising security. Best Practices for Implementing Medical Transcription Apps in Healthcare
To fully harness the advantages of medical transcription apps, healthcare providers should adhere to several best practices during the implementation process:
-
Choose the Right App: Selecting a transcription app that meets the unique needs of your practice is crucial. It’s essential to ensure that the app integrates seamlessly with existing Electronic Health Record (EHR) systems. This integration facilitates smooth data flow and enhances overall efficiency, addressing the fragmentation often observed in medical service delivery.
-
Train Staff: Comprehensive training for all users is vital. This training should encompass the app's features and functionalities, ensuring that staff members feel confident and competent in utilizing the technology effectively. Successful training programs significantly improve user satisfaction and operational efficiency, which is essential in alleviating physician burnout.
-
Establish Protocols: Developing clear protocols for app usage is important. This includes guidelines for data entry, security measures, and compliance with HIPAA regulations. Establishing these protocols helps maintain data integrity and safeguards individual information, which is paramount in healthcare settings, especially given the regulatory challenges that can hinder communication.
-
Monitor Performance: Regularly assessing the app's performance is necessary to ensure it meets the evolving needs of the practice. Collecting input from users can help recognize areas for enhancement, facilitating modifications that improve functionality and user experience, ultimately resulting in better outcomes.
-
Stay Updated: Keeping abreast of updates and new features offered by the app is important for maximizing its potential. Utilizing advancements in technology can enhance efficiency and precision in documentation, ultimately benefiting care for individuals.
